The 2007–08 Atlanta Hawks season was the team's 59th season of the franchise in the National Basketball Association (NBA) and the 40th in Atlanta. After missing the playoffs for eight straight seasons, the Hawks selected Al Horford out of the University of Florida with the third pick in the 2007 NBA draft. The Hawks started out the season by defeating the Dallas Mavericks 101–94 in their season opener, marking the first time they won their first game of the season since the 1999 lockout season. However, their struggles continued as they went on a six-game losing streak around the All-Star break. At midseason, the Hawks traded Tyronn Lue, Lorenzen Wright, Anthony Johnson, and second-year forward Shelden Williams to the Sacramento Kings for Mike Bibby. The Hawks finished third in the Southeast Division with a 37–45 record, and made the playoffs for the first time since 1999. Joe Johnson averaged 21.7 points per game, and was selected for the 2008 NBA All-Star Game. Josh Smith provided the team with 17.2 points, 8.2 rebounds, and 2.8 blocks per game, while Horford averaged 10.1 points and 9.7 rebounds per game, and made the NBA All-Rookie First Team.

In the first round of the

playoffs, they lost to the top-seeded Boston Celtics in seven games. With their 37-45 (0.451) record, the 2008 Hawks are the worst team record-wise to push an eventual NBA Champion to an elimination game. Coincidentally, the Hawks in 2014 would be the 8th seed at 38-44 and take the top seeded conference finalist Indiana Pacers to a 7 game series. Following the season, Josh Childress
left to play overseas.
